Bump Rust to version 1.77
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
When trying to build rowan we get this error

    error: package `rowan v0.15.16` cannot be built because
    it requires rustc 1.77.0 or newer, while the currently active rustc
    version is 1.75.0

So let's upgrade to 1.77 to allow us to build rowan.
